gpt4 book ai didi

javascript - 包裹在 setTimeout 中时出现错误 "Cannot read property of undefined"

转载 作者:数据小太阳 更新时间:2023-10-29 05:14:29 29 4
gpt4 key购买 nike

<分区>

我一直在编写一段代码,旨在处理单个网页上的多个小视频元素,但我无法使多个进度条与其各自的视频同步。

( Current jsFiddle prototype )

这段代码 $(this).find("progress").attr("value", $("video", this)[0].currentTime); 似乎有效在主函数中,但是当我用 setTimeout 将它包装在另一个函数中时,进度条实际上是动画的,我得到了这个错误:

"Cannot read property 'currentTime' of undefined at function"

我已经尝试了一些变体,看看我是否可以自己让它工作,但我无法像往常一样通过将代码扔到墙上来修复它。

谁能告诉我为什么会这样?

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com